Why can we not reference form variables in a choice control? This seems like a pretty well-needed place for accessing variables. How do you get around a choice control when you need to build them on the form, such as current year minus 1?

because choice options has to be known when form is being rendered, and variable values aren't known at that moment yet.

 

possible workaround migh be to provide list of option from a list field

see this post - https://community.nintex.com/t5/Nintex-for-SharePoint/Checklist-based-on-value/m-p/46402/highlight/true#M38457

 

 

but for your specific case I'd stick to date control. see following examples how to restrict what dates/years are selectable from the control.
